<u><em>The complete question is</em></u>

The Fuller family wants to drive to a national park. Some information about their trip is given in the  table below.

Distance to national park 515 miles

Car’s gas tank capacity 20 gallons

Average gas mileage for car 26 miles per gallon

The family wants to determine if they can drive to the national park using just one tank of gas in their  car. Determine whether the Fullers can reach the national park. Show your work or explain your  answer.

we know that

The Average gas mileage for the car is 26 miles per gallon

That means

With 1 gallon the car runs 26 miles

so

using a proportion

Find out how many miles the car runs with 20 gallons (one tank of gas)

\frac{26}{1}\ \frac{miles}{gallon}=\frac{x}{20}\ \frac{miles}{gallons}\\\\x=26(20)\\\\x=520\ miles

Compare with the distance to the national park

520\ miles>515\ miles

therefore

The Fullers can reach the national park
